Economic calendar: PMIs from Europe and US

  • European markets seen opening higher

  • PMI releases from Germany, France, UK and US

  • 2 Dow Jones members report earnings

Futures markets point to a slightly higher opening of the European session. While ECB meeting was a big event of the day, there is still more to come on Friday! 

Flash PMI release from Europe and the United States will be released throughout the day. Data from Germany and France is expected to show slightly weaker readings for manufacturing but higher ones for services. Similar pattern is expected from US data in the afternoon. Both indices from UK are seen dropping.

When it comes to earnings releases, investors will be offered reports from 2 Dow Jones members - American Express and Honeywell

8:15 am BST - France, PMI indices for July.

  • Manufacturing. Expected: 58.3. Previous: 59.0

  • Services. Expected: 59.0. Previous: 57.8

8:30 am BST - Germany, PMI indices for July.

  • Manufacturing. Expected: 64.2. Previous: 65.1

  • Services. Expected: 59.5. Previous: 57.5

9:00 am BST - Euro area, PMI indices for July.

  • Manufacturing. Expected: 62.5. Previous: 63.4

  • Services. Expected: 59.5. Previous: 58.3

9:30 am BST - UK, PMI indices for July.

  • Manufacturing. Expected: 62.7. Previous: 63.9

  • Services. Expected: 62.0. Previous: 62.4

1:30 pm BST - Canada, retail sales for May.

  • Headline. Expected: -3.0% MoM. Previous: -5.7% MoM

  • Ex-autos. Expected: -2.0% MoM. Previous: -7.2% MoM

2:45 pm BST - US, PMI indices for July.

  • Manufacturing. Expected: 61.9. Previous: 62.1

  • Services. Expected: 64.8. Previous: 64.6

US earnings releases

  • American Express (AXP.US) - before market open

  • Honeywell International (HON.US) - before market open

  • Nextera Energy (NEE.US) - before market open

  • Schlumberger (SLB.US) - before market open
